Net inflows into US spot Bitcoin exchange-traded funds (ETFs) continued.

According to data compiled by TraderT on Feb. 10 (local time), total net inflows into Bitcoin ETFs on Feb. 10 reached $166.56 million.

By fund, BlackRock’s IBIT posted net inflows of $26.53 million, while Fidelity’s FBTC recorded $56.92 million. ARK Invest’s ARKB saw $68.53 million in inflows, marking the largest net inflow of the day.

Valkyrie’s BRRR recorded net inflows of $4.86 million, WisdomTree’s BTCW $3.64 million, and the Grayscale Bitcoin Mini Trust $6.08 million.

Meanwhile, Bitwise’s BITB, Invesco’s BTCO, Franklin’s EZBC, VanEck’s HODL and Grayscale’s GBTC were flat, with no net outflows or inflows.
